The New York Times (USA)
The New York Times, often dubbed "The Gray Lady," is a U.S. newspaper with a global reach and influence. Founded in 1851, it has a long history of journalistic excellence, winning numerous Pulitzer Prizes for its reporting. Known for its in-depth coverage of national and international affairs, the NYT also features sections on culture, business, science, and lifestyle. Its online presence is robust, with a vast digital archive and a growing subscriber base. The New York Times' commitment to investigative journalism and its ability to shape public discourse make it a leading voice in global media. The newspaper has consistently adapted to the changing media landscape, embracing digital platforms and innovative storytelling techniques to remain relevant and impactful.
The Wall Street Journal (USA)
The Wall Street Journal, another prominent U.S. newspaper, focuses on business and financial news. Founded in 1889, it is highly respected for its accurate and insightful coverage of the global economy, financial markets, and corporate affairs. The WSJ is a must-read for investors, business leaders, and anyone interested in the world of finance. In addition to its business coverage, the Wall Street Journal also features sections on politics, culture, and lifestyle. Its strong reputation for accuracy and its focus on business news make it a unique and influential voice in the media landscape. The newspaper's digital presence has grown significantly, with a large online subscriber base and a variety of interactive features.
The Washington Post (USA)
The Washington Post gained prominence for its coverage of the Watergate scandal, which led to President Richard Nixon's resignation. Since then, it has continued to be a leading voice in U.S. politics and investigative journalism. Owned by Jeff Bezos, the Post has invested heavily in its digital presence and expanded its coverage to include a wider range of topics, from technology to culture. The Washington Post's commitment to accountability and its ability to uncover important stories make it a crucial source of information for policymakers and the public alike. The newspaper has also embraced innovative storytelling techniques, such as data journalism and multimedia presentations, to engage readers and enhance its coverage.
The Guardian (UK)
The Guardian is a British newspaper known for its progressive and liberal perspective. Founded in 1821, it has a long history of advocating for social justice and human rights. The Guardian is respected for its in-depth coverage of UK and international news, as well as its strong focus on investigative journalism and environmental issues. Its online presence is global, with a large international readership and a commitment to open access journalism. The Guardian's unique ownership structure, which places it in a trust dedicated to journalistic integrity, ensures its independence and commitment to public service.
The Times (UK)
The Times, another influential British newspaper, has a history dating back to 1785. Known for its comprehensive coverage of UK and international news, the Times is respected for its accuracy and its ability to provide in-depth analysis of complex issues. The newspaper has a long tradition of journalistic excellence and has played a significant role in shaping British public opinion. The Times' online presence has grown significantly, with a large subscriber base and a variety of interactive features. Its commitment to quality journalism and its ability to adapt to the changing media landscape make it a leading voice in the UK.

El PaÃs (Spain)
El PaÃs is a leading Spanish newspaper known for its comprehensive coverage of Spanish and international news. Founded in 1976, it has played a significant role in Spain's transition to democracy and is respected for its commitment to journalistic integrity. El PaÃs is widely read in Spain and Latin America and is considered a leading voice in the Spanish-speaking world. The newspaper's online presence has grown significantly, with a large subscriber base and a variety of interactive features. El PaÃs' commitment to quality journalism and its ability to adapt to the changing media landscape make it a crucial source of information in Spain.
